All activities, including PADI scuba dive training; coral reef ecology and science training; scuba gear (BCD, regulator, dive, computer dive compass, weights and fins); career development support; survey diving; island transport; food; WiFi; accommodation; gym access and in-country support are included in programme costs, which start at $2750 for a 4-week expedition.

Flights, insurance, visa, vaccinations, PADI manuals and personal dive equipment (mask; snorkel; wetsuit; booties) are not included. Advice and fundraising support will happily be provided upon request.

About Program

Join our research team and take part in meaningful conservation research on a stunning tropical island. Working alongside a team of experienced conservation professionals, you will gain unique hands-on experience in marine conservation and dedicated support to help you embark on your career.

Marine survey data collected by volunteers directly contributes to the development and management of Cambodia's first marine protected area, meaning your work will have a meaningful impact on marine conservation in the region.

* Gain personalised, career-focused experience within pioneering marine conservation research
* Engage in our unique coral reef ecology course with a passionate team
* Learn to dive (PADI Advanced) and lead biophysical marine surveys
* Live and work in a traditional, remote Cambodian fishing community
* Propel your career through our 'Career Catalyst' professional development course
* Experience our sustainable development and community conservation initiatives
